Analysis

Turkmenistan recorded -2.11 % change on previous year for secondary education, pupils, annual growth rate in 2024. That is the lowest value across all 5 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 111.9% on the previous year and down 136.6% over five years.

That places Turkmenistan 177th out of 205 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.

Secondary education, pupils, annual growth rate in Turkmenistan, year by year

Annual values for Secondary education, pupils, annual growth rate in Turkmenistan, 2020 to 2024.
Year % change on previous year Change
2020 5.76 % change on previous year
2021 7.67 % change on previous year +33.1%
2022 8.17 % change on previous year +6.5%
2023 17.67 % change on previous year +116.3%
2024 -2.11 % change on previous year -111.9%

How this figure is calculated

The year-on-year percentage change in Secondary education, pupils.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
